The Lovepools are a Los Angeles indie rock and synth pop trio created by Anthony Shea (Vocals, Synths, Guitars, Production) assisted by Devin McGee on drums and Aria Cruz on bass. Each production is recorded and produced entirely within Anthony's bedroom in Logic Pro X.
Following the release of two EPs, The Lovepools first single, "See You In The Funny Papers," was featured on Showtime's "Shameless" Season 9 Premiere. The track drew comparisons to The Black Keys and Arctic Monkeys for its fuzz guitars and clever lyrics.
The next break for the group came in May 2020, when the band inked a record deal with Sword Music (distribution by Sony Music Italy). This paved the way for a series of singles, most notably "White Lies & Palm Trees" a synthpop anthem inspired by groups like Foster The People and Empire of the Sun. The ethereal track graced the airwaves of major Italian radio stations and college radio across the US. A live action/animation music video was promptly released and seen on Italian TV including MTV Italy.
In October of 2020, the Lovepools continued their momentum with their own remix "White Lies & Palm Trees (Pool House Remix)" which was quickly selected for editorial Spotify playlist: "Voglia Di Sol", appearing there for well over a year.
After a two year hiatus, the group began performing live again and on September 15th, 2023, Something = Nothing marked their next synthpop release. The song garnered positive critical acclaim and was praised for its production and lyrics.
“One Note Wonder” marks the trio’s new indie rock single set to be released this year on December 15th with a release party at Good Times at Davey Wayne’s on Thursday, December 14th at 10:00pm.
